Calculate Skew Angle from URI in OCR Image Recognition

Introduction

Welcome to the world of Aspose.OCR for .NET! In this comprehensive tutorial, we will delve into the intricacies of utilizing Aspose.OCR for .NET to calculate the skew angle from a URI in OCR image recognition. This powerful tool opens up new possibilities in optical character recognition, making the process smoother and more efficient.

Prerequisites

Before we embark on this journey, let’s ensure you have everything in place:

Import Namespaces

Ensure you have the necessary namespaces imported into your project. This step is crucial for seamless integration with Aspose.OCR for .NET. Include the following namespaces:

using System;
using System.Collections.Generic;
using System.Drawing;
using System.IO;
using Aspose.OCR;
using Aspose.OCR.Models.PreprocessingFilters;

Now, let’s break down each example into multiple steps.

Step 1: Initialize Aspose.OCR

// Initialize an instance of AsposeOcr
AsposeOcr api = new AsposeOcr();

Here, we create an instance of AsposeOcr, laying the foundation for subsequent operations.

Step 2: Calculate Angle

// Calculate Angle
float angle = api.CalculateSkewFromUri("https://i.stack.imgur.com/0A4M9.png");

In this step, we utilize the CalculateSkewFromUri method to determine the skew angle of the image located at the specified URI.

Step 3: Display the Result

// Display the result
Console.WriteLine(angle);

Print the calculated angle to the console, providing valuable insights into the skew of the OCR image.

Step 4: Conclusion

// ExEnd:1

Console.WriteLine("CalculateSkewAngleFromUri executed successfully");

Here, we mark the end of our example, indicating successful execution.

Conclusion

Congratulations! You’ve successfully navigated through the process of calculating skew angles using Aspose.OCR for .NET. This tutorial has equipped you with the skills to enhance your OCR image recognition projects.

FAQ’s

Q1: Can I use Aspose.OCR for .NET with other programming languages?

A1: Aspose.OCR primarily supports .NET languages, but you can explore wrappers for other languages.

Q2: Is a temporary license available for Aspose.OCR for .NET?

A2: Yes, you can obtain a temporary license here.

Q3: How can I seek help or engage with the community for support?

A3: Visit the Aspose.OCR forum for community support and discussions.

Q4: Are there any prerequisites before using Aspose.OCR for .NET?

A4: Ensure you have the required namespaces imported into your project, as outlined in the tutorial.

Q5: Where can I find comprehensive documentation for Aspose.OCR for .NET?

A5: Refer to the documentation for detailed information.